how to properly level a crapper over ceramic tile

i put down new tile in the bathroom, and it's uneven, due to floor being poured by locals.

anyways, how do I get the potty to set even, without looking bad?

i had a big peice of plastic wedged under it before. looked like crap.

i'm trying to sell the house, only reason doing it.

04CTD-

All you have to do is get a container of plumbers putty, take a bunch in your hands and roll it into a 3/4" roll about as long as it will take to cover the lower flange (base). then put your crapper down on the floor and put alot of EVEN pressure in it. Then cut the extra off around the base and your done.

I've done this and it works great, Don't shim it use PLUMBERS PUTTY!

All of the above, you are selling it! Use bathroom caulk to finish off the bead where the crapper meets the floor then take your finger and smooth it out. It will look like a million bucks. If it still looks bad buy one of those rugs that fits arouns the stool that yoiu can put your feet on too. It will cover it up.
